The C-10 Work Permit (Significant Benefit Work Permit) is designed for individuals whose work in Canada would create or maintain significant social, cultural or economic benefits for Canadians. This permit offers unique pathways for self-employed professionals and entrepreneurs seeking to establish their presence in Canada.
Under other work permits, the C-10 category doesn't require a Labour Market Impact Assessment (LMIA), making it an attractive option for qualified individuals who can demonstrate substantial benefits to Canada.

Your work must demonstrate significant economic, social, or cultural benefit to Canada, such as job creation, knowledge transfer, or cultural enrichment.
A comprehensive business plan and relevant professional experience that demonstrates your ability to deliver the promised benefits to Canada.
